Delen via


ServersOperations Klas

ServersOperations-bewerkingen.

U moet deze klasse niet rechtstreeks instantiëren. In plaats daarvan moet u een clientexemplaar maken dat het voor u instanteert en deze als een kenmerk koppelt.

Overname
builtins.object
ServersOperations

Constructor

ServersOperations(client, config, serializer, deserializer)

Parameters

client
Vereist

Client voor serviceaanvragen.

config
Vereist

Configuratie van serviceclient.

serializer
Vereist

Een serialisatiefunctie voor objectmodellen.

deserializer
Vereist

Een objectmodeldeserialisatiefunctie.

Variabelen

models

Alias voor modelklassen die in deze bewerkingsgroep worden gebruikt.

Methoden

begin_create

Hiermee maakt u een nieuwe server.

begin_delete

Hiermee verwijdert u een server.

begin_restart

Start een server opnieuw op.

begin_start

Hiermee start u een server.

begin_stop

Stopt een server.

begin_update

Updates een bestaande server. De aanvraagbody kan een of veel van de eigenschappen bevatten die aanwezig zijn in de normale serverdefinitie.

get

Hiermee haalt u informatie op over een server.

list

Alle servers in een bepaald abonnement weergeven.

list_by_resource_group

Alle servers in een bepaalde resourcegroep weergeven.

begin_create

Hiermee maakt u een nieuwe server.

begin_create(resource_group_name: str, server_name: str, parameters: '_models.Server', **kwargs: Any) -> LROPoller['_models.Server']

Parameters

resource_group_name
str
Vereist

De naam van de resourcegroep. De naam is niet hoofdlettergevoelig.

server_name
str
Vereist

De naam van de server.

parameters
Server
Vereist

De vereiste parameters voor het maken of bijwerken van een server.

cls
callable

Een aangepast type of aangepaste functie die de directe reactie doorgeeft

continuation_token
str

Een vervolgtoken om een poller opnieuw te starten vanuit een opgeslagen status.

polling
bool of PollingMethod

Standaard is de pollingmethode ARMPolling. Geef onwaar door om deze bewerking niet te peilen, of geef uw eigen geïnitialiseerde pollingobject door voor een persoonlijke pollingstrategie.

polling_interval
int

Standaardwachttijd tussen twee polls voor LRO-bewerkingen als er geen Retry-After header aanwezig is.

Retouren

Een exemplaar van LROPoller dat server of het resultaat van cls(response) retourneert

Retourtype

Uitzonderingen

begin_delete

Hiermee verwijdert u een server.

begin_delete(resource_group_name: str, server_name: str, **kwargs: Any) -> LROPoller[None]

Parameters

resource_group_name
str
Vereist

De naam van de resourcegroep. De naam is niet hoofdlettergevoelig.

server_name
str
Vereist

De naam van de server.

cls
callable

Een aangepast type of aangepaste functie die de directe reactie doorgeeft

continuation_token
str

Een vervolgtoken om een poller opnieuw te starten vanuit een opgeslagen status.

polling
bool of PollingMethod

Standaard is de pollingmethode ARMPolling. Geef onwaar door om deze bewerking niet te peilen, of geef uw eigen geïnitialiseerde pollingobject door voor een persoonlijke pollingstrategie.

polling_interval
int

Standaardwachttijd tussen twee polls voor LRO-bewerkingen als er geen Retry-After header aanwezig is.

Retouren

Een exemplaar van LROPoller dat Geen of het resultaat van cls(response) retourneert

Retourtype

Uitzonderingen

begin_restart

Start een server opnieuw op.

begin_restart(resource_group_name: str, server_name: str, parameters: '_models.RestartParameter' | None = None, **kwargs: Any) -> LROPoller[None]

Parameters

resource_group_name
str
Vereist

De naam van de resourcegroep. De naam is niet hoofdlettergevoelig.

server_name
str
Vereist

De naam van de server.

parameters
RestartParameter
standaardwaarde: None

De parameters voor het opnieuw opstarten van een server.

cls
callable

Een aangepast type of aangepaste functie die de directe reactie doorgeeft

continuation_token
str

Een vervolgtoken om een poller opnieuw te starten vanuit een opgeslagen status.

polling
bool of PollingMethod

Standaard is de pollingmethode ARMPolling. Geef onwaar door om deze bewerking niet te peilen, of geef uw eigen geïnitialiseerde pollingobject door voor een persoonlijke pollingstrategie.

polling_interval
int

Standaardwachttijd tussen twee polls voor LRO-bewerkingen als er geen Retry-After header aanwezig is.

Retouren

Een exemplaar van LROPoller dat Geen of het resultaat van cls(response) retourneert

Retourtype

Uitzonderingen

begin_start

Hiermee start u een server.

begin_start(resource_group_name: str, server_name: str, **kwargs: Any) -> LROPoller[None]

Parameters

resource_group_name
str
Vereist

De naam van de resourcegroep. De naam is niet hoofdlettergevoelig.

server_name
str
Vereist

De naam van de server.

cls
callable

Een aangepast type of aangepaste functie die de directe reactie doorgeeft

continuation_token
str

Een vervolgtoken om een poller opnieuw te starten vanuit een opgeslagen status.

polling
bool of PollingMethod

Standaard is de pollingmethode ARMPolling. Geef onwaar door om deze bewerking niet te peilen, of geef uw eigen geïnitialiseerde pollingobject door voor een persoonlijke pollingstrategie.

polling_interval
int

Standaardwachttijd tussen twee polls voor LRO-bewerkingen als er geen Retry-After header aanwezig is.

Retouren

Een exemplaar van LROPoller dat Geen of het resultaat van cls(response) retourneert

Retourtype

Uitzonderingen

begin_stop

Stopt een server.

begin_stop(resource_group_name: str, server_name: str, **kwargs: Any) -> LROPoller[None]

Parameters

resource_group_name
str
Vereist

De naam van de resourcegroep. De naam is niet hoofdlettergevoelig.

server_name
str
Vereist

De naam van de server.

cls
callable

Een aangepast type of aangepaste functie die de directe reactie doorgeeft

continuation_token
str

Een vervolgtoken om een poller opnieuw te starten vanuit een opgeslagen status.

polling
bool of PollingMethod

Standaard is de pollingmethode ARMPolling. Geef onwaar door om deze bewerking niet te peilen, of geef uw eigen geïnitialiseerde pollingobject door voor een persoonlijke pollingstrategie.

polling_interval
int

Standaardwachttijd tussen twee polls voor LRO-bewerkingen als er geen Retry-After header aanwezig is.

Retouren

Een exemplaar van LROPoller dat Geen of het resultaat van cls(response) retourneert

Retourtype

Uitzonderingen

begin_update

Updates een bestaande server. De aanvraagbody kan een of veel van de eigenschappen bevatten die aanwezig zijn in de normale serverdefinitie.

begin_update(resource_group_name: str, server_name: str, parameters: '_models.ServerForUpdate', **kwargs: Any) -> LROPoller['_models.Server']

Parameters

resource_group_name
str
Vereist

De naam van de resourcegroep. De naam is niet hoofdlettergevoelig.

server_name
str
Vereist

De naam van de server.

parameters
ServerForUpdate
Vereist

De vereiste parameters voor het bijwerken van een server.

cls
callable

Een aangepast type of aangepaste functie die de directe reactie doorgeeft

continuation_token
str

Een vervolgtoken om een poller opnieuw te starten vanuit een opgeslagen status.

polling
bool of PollingMethod

Standaard is de pollingmethode ARMPolling. Geef onwaar door om deze bewerking niet te peilen, of geef uw eigen geïnitialiseerde pollingobject door voor een persoonlijke pollingstrategie.

polling_interval
int

Standaardwachttijd tussen twee polls voor LRO-bewerkingen als er geen Retry-After header aanwezig is.

Retouren

Een exemplaar van LROPoller dat server of het resultaat van cls(response) retourneert

Retourtype

Uitzonderingen

get

Hiermee haalt u informatie op over een server.

get(resource_group_name: str, server_name: str, **kwargs: Any) -> _models.Server

Parameters

resource_group_name
str
Vereist

De naam van de resourcegroep. De naam is niet hoofdlettergevoelig.

server_name
str
Vereist

De naam van de server.

cls
callable

Een aangepast type of aangepaste functie die de directe reactie doorgeeft

Retouren

Server of het resultaat van cls(response)

Retourtype

Uitzonderingen

list

Alle servers in een bepaald abonnement weergeven.

list(**kwargs: Any) -> Iterable['_models.ServerListResult']

Parameters

cls
callable

Een aangepast type of aangepaste functie die de directe reactie doorgeeft

Retouren

Een iterator zoals een exemplaar van ServerListResult of het resultaat van cls(response)

Retourtype

Uitzonderingen

list_by_resource_group

Alle servers in een bepaalde resourcegroep weergeven.

list_by_resource_group(resource_group_name: str, **kwargs: Any) -> Iterable['_models.ServerListResult']

Parameters

resource_group_name
str
Vereist

De naam van de resourcegroep. De naam is niet hoofdlettergevoelig.

cls
callable

Een aangepast type of aangepaste functie die de directe reactie doorgeeft

Retouren

Een iterator zoals een exemplaar van ServerListResult of het resultaat van cls(response)

Retourtype

Uitzonderingen

Kenmerken

models

models = <module 'azure.mgmt.rdbms.postgresql_flexibleservers.models' from 'C:\\hostedtoolcache\\windows\\Python\\3.11.7\\x64\\Lib\\site-packages\\azure\\mgmt\\rdbms\\postgresql_flexibleservers\\models\\__init__.py'>